Summary: (Taken from Amazon)
Since his mother’s death six years ago, Carter Kane has been living out of a suitcase, traveling the globe with his father, the brilliant Egyptologist Dr. Julius Kane. But while Carter’s been homeschooled, his younger sister, Sadie, has been living with their grandparents in London. Sadie has just what Carter wants — school friends and a chance at a “normal” life. But Carter has just what Sadie longs for — time with their father. After six years of living apart, the siblings have almost nothing in common. Until now.
On Christmas Eve, Sadie and Carter are reunited when their father brings them to the British Museum, with a promise that he’s going to “make things right.” But all does not go according to plan: Carter and Sadie watch as Julius summons a mysterious figure, who quickly banishes their father and causes a fiery explosion.
Soon Carter and Sadie discover that the gods of Ancient Egypt are waking, and the worst of them — Set — has a frightening scheme. To save their father, they must embark on a dangerous journey — a quest that brings them ever closer to the truth about their family and its links to the House of Life, a secret order that has existed since the time of the pharaohs.

Summary: (Taken from Wikipedia)
Percy Jackson, his friends, and the Olympians fight in a war resembling the original war between the Greek gods and the Titans and in a final battle with the powerful Titan, Kronos. Many fight for Olympus, including the Hunters of Artemis, dryads, satyrs, naiads, and tree nymphs, Chiron's centaur cousins the Party Ponies, and the hellhound Mrs. O'Leary. They must defend Mt. Olympus from Kronos' huge army consisting of rogue half-bloods, dracaenae, Hyperboreans, Laestrygonians, drakon, Hyperion, telekhines, Typhon, and hellhounds.
It is revealed that Luke had bathed in the River Styx, thus becoming nearly invincible (much like Achilles). Seeking to defeat Kronos, Percy does the same, with some encouragement from Nico. Rachel, a mortal who can see through the Mist, tells Percy that he is not the hero of the Great Prophecy and that it will influence his choice when he turns 16.

SUMMARY: (Taken from Wikipedia)
After being attacked by Empousai cheerleaders at his new school, Percy returns to Camp Half-Blood and learns about "The Labyrinth", part of the palace of King Minos in Crete that, according to Greek mythology, was designed by Daedalus. During a game of capture the flag at the camp, Annabeth and Percy find an entrance into the Labyrinth. Percy soon learns that Luke had used the entrance and will try and lead his army through the Labyrinth straight in to the heart of Camp Half-Blood.
Using the Labyrinth, Percy has to try to find Daedalus so Luke cannot get Ariadne's string, thereby foiling Luke's invasion. Ariadne's string is used to navigate the Labyrinth. Following a hint, Percy travels to Mt. St. Helens, causing it to erupt, and wiping his energy out. After being treated for burns by Calypso, Percy gets the help he needs from a mortal girl named Rachel Elizabeth Dare, who proves herself by hitting Kronos in the eye with a blue plastic hairbrush. Kronos finds out that Nico di Angelo is a son of Hades and also could be the child of the big prophecy. Luke reaches Daedalus and gets Ariadne's string. Using the magical instrument, he leads his army and attacks camp. Grover comes to the rescue and causes a panic to scare away the enemy. After the battle, Daedalus sacrifices himself to close the labyrinth, which is tied to his life.[
